Sue

Professional Background and Movement Philosophy

Sue is a STOTT PILATES®–certified instructor in London, specialising in mat Pilates and reformer Pilates. Her professional background in dance technology and digital content creationgives her a deep understanding of biomechanics, movement efficiency, and the physical impact of modern working environments.

After experiencing recurring injuries, Sue identified that long hours at a computer—not dancing—were the root cause. Pilates became the solution that restored balance, strength, and resilience in her body. This experience shaped her movement philosophy: Pilates should not only build strength and flexibility, but also correct imbalances, improve posture, and support long‑term physical health.
